javascript - 将表添加到我的 dojo 代码中

标签 javascript dialog dojo

我有一个 dojo 对话框函数,希望能够向其中添加一个包含 5 行的表。我怎样才能做到这一点?下面是我的代码。

dojo.require("dijit.Dialog");
    dojo.require("dijit.form.TextBox");
    dojo.require("dojox.grid.EnhancedGrid");
    dojo.addOnLoad(function() {
    popup = new dijit.Dialog({
    title: "Non-Spatial Permanent Feature Deductions...",
    style: "width: 750px; height: 400px", 
    content: "<input dojoType='dijit.form.Button' type='button' name='name' id='name' label='OK'>" 
 });
    popup.show()
});

最佳答案

如果您的表格行是固定的,即 5 行,那么您可以做一件简单的事情,即创建一个包含 5 行的表格的 html 文件并在对话框内调用该文件。

popup = new dijit.Dialog({
    title: "Non-Spatial Permanent Feature Deductions...",
    style: "width: 750px; height: 400px", 
    href:"table.html" 
 });

关于javascript - 将表添加到我的 dojo 代码中,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18018465/

相关文章:

javascript - 进行 AJAX 调用,得到 "Uncaught Reference Error"

javascript - 在我的情况下如何强制 ipad 进入横向模式

linux - 哪个开源程序类似于Linux "dialog"命令?

css - Dojo dijit 框架与一些 CSS 框架

javascript - 为什么 dojo build 将所有包创建为层?

javascript - 单击按钮时进行 Dojo 表单验证

javascript - 使用事件克隆 HTML 元素

javascript - 为什么 clean 命令在 Gradle React native 项目中不起作用?

c++ - 找到控件相对于其父窗口的位置的最佳方法是什么?

dialog - Testcafe studio - 如何处理原生对话框